Elementary Lesson Year Two, Quarter Three, Lesson Eleven SUNDAY SCHOOL LESSON The Life of Jesus AIM: to teach my class that Jesus always knows what is best for us. OBJECTS TO HAVE: Pictures of people that you love to go and visit Letters or postcards from someone who lives in another town, state, or country A handkerchief, for crying A sheet, to show what grave clothes are made of A picture of a cave A picture of a big stone Your Bible POINT OF CONTACT: I have friends who live in towns that are far away from here. I don t get to see them very often, but every time I am in their area I stop by to visit them. Sometimes I like to call them on the phone. Sometimes I will write them letters. And sometimes they write letters to me. Do you have a friend or a cousin that lives somewhere far away, and sometimes you get to go visit them? Tell me about somebody like that whom you know. STORY: Jesus had friends like that also. Of course, Jesus spent His life traveling from town to town and from city to city. Jesus never spent very long in one city, because He needed to move on to the next town to tell people how to go to heaven. But everywhere that Jesus went He made new friends. So when Jesus would be in a town where one of His friends lived, often they would invite Him to come eat with them. One town where Jesus had some friends was the town of Bethany. In Bethany lived two sisters and a brother who were very good friends with Jesus. The sisters were named Mary and Martha, and their brother was named Lazarus. It was Jesus who had told Mary, Martha, and Lazarus how to be saved, and Jesus had done many good things for them. Mary, Martha, and Lazarus loved Jesus very much. Whenever Jesus was anywhere near the town of Bethany, He would stop at the house of Mary, Martha and Lazarus to visit with them. Jesus loved to visit with them, and they loved to serve Jesus, and to sit and listen to Him talk. Since Jesus was so close to Mary, Martha and Lazarus, they knew that any time that they had a need or a problem, Jesus would be there to help them with it. That is why what happens in the story that I am going to tell you today did not make much sense to Mary and Martha, or to Jesus disciples. You see, one day while Jesus was preaching in a town far away from Bethany, Lazarus became very sick. Mary and Martha were very concerned about their brother Lazarus. They had never seen him this sick before. They knew that the one person who could help Lazarus was Jesus. But they also knew that Jesus was preaching very far away from their town. So Mary and Martha sent a messenger to Jesus. They told the messenger, Go find Jesus, and tell Him that His friend Lazarus of Bethany is very sick. That messenger began to search for Jesus. It wasn t long before the messenger found Jesus, and he gave Jesus the message: Mary and Martha sent me to tell you that their brother Lazarus is very sick. They think that he might die. Jesus simply said, Thank you for the message. Jesus disciples thought that Jesus would say, Let s go! We ve got to get to Bethany right away. But He didn t. Instead Jesus said, Lazarus will not die of this sickness. He is only sick so that people will know that I am the Son of God. And then, Jesus stayed in the town where He was for two more days! After two days Jesus said, Lazarus is dead now. Let s go to Bethany. One of Jesus disciples, named Thomas, said, Why go now? He s already dead. We can t do anything now! By the time Jesus and His disciples arrived in Bethany, Lazarus had been dead and buried for four days. They had wrapped his body in grave clothes and buried him in a cave. Many people were gathered at Mary and Martha s

house, to try to comfort them about the death of their brother. Someone came into the house and whispered to Martha, Jesus is coming to see you. Martha got up and went out to meet Him. When Jesus came to Martha, she said, Lord, if you had been here, Lazarus would not have died. Jesus explained to Martha that He had the power to bring Lazarus out of the grave. Martha said, Lord, I know that that will happen some day, when his body will rise from the grave and we will all be in heaven together. That is called the resurrection. Jesus said, I am the resurrection, and the life. He that believeth in me, though he were dead, yet shall he live. And whosoever liveth and believeth in me shall never die. Then He asked Martha, Do you believe that? Martha said, Yes, Lord, I believe that you are the Son of God. Then immediately, Martha went back in the house and got Mary. Mary came out and found Jesus. She fell at His feet and said the same thing that Martha had said: Lord, if you had been here, Lazarus would not have died. Then Mary began to weep and cry. Behind Mary came many of the friends of the family, and they were also weeping and crying for their friend, Lazarus. Then Jesus said, Where is Lazarus buried? They walked toward the burial place and said to Jesus, Come, we will show you. Jesus followed them to the grave, which was a cave like this one, with a stone rolled in front of the door. As Jesus looked at the spot where his friend Lazarus was buried, Jesus wept. Everyone around Jesus said, Jesus really loved His friend Lazarus. But if He loved Lazarus so much, I wonder why He was not here to heal Him. This is the man who heals so many people. Why didn t He come to heal His own friend? Then Jesus said, Move the stone away from the door. Martha said, Jesus, he s been buried for four days. If you go in there, the smell will be awful. Jesus said, Martha, didn t I tell you that I am the resurrection and the life? The men moved the stone away from the door of the cave, and Jesus looked to heaven and began to pray loudly: Father, thank you for hearing and answering my prayer. I pray that you will show all of the people standing here that you sent me. Then Jesus looked at the cave and said, LAZARUS, COME FORTH. Suddenly, the body of Lazarus appeared in the doorway of the cave. The people could not believe their eyes! They watched as Lazarus walked out in his grave clothes. Then Jesus said, Loose him and let him go. The people took the grave clothes off of Lazarus, and they watched as Lazarus, raised from the dead, came and worshipped Jesus, and hugged and kissed his sisters. The Bible says that many people got saved that day because of the amazing miracle that they saw. Now kids, I want you to think about something. None of these people could understand why Jesus did not come to heal Lazarus before he died. But what would have been a more amazing miracle: for Lazarus to be healed of his sickness, or for him to die and then be raised from the dead? That s right, to be raised from the dead. So when Jesus waited before He came to Bethany, He knew what He was doing, didn t He? He knew that He had to wait, so that the city of Bethany could see an even greater miracle. And He also taught Mary and Martha to trust God more than they did. Many times things happen and people say, Why would God allow that to happen? But I want you to remember this: GOD ALWAYS KNOWS WHAT HE IS DOING. You and I are not smart enough to know what needs to be done in every situation. But God knows. GOD ALWAYS KNOWS WHAT HE IS DOING. Say that with me, ready: GOD ALWAYS KNOWS WHAT HE IS DOING. Again: GOD ALWAYS KNOWS WHAT HE IS DOING. When things happen in life that make us cry, GOD ALWAYS KNOWS WHAT HE IS DOING. When we are disappointed by something that somebody does, GOD ALWAYS KNOWS WHAT HE IS DOING. When things don t go like we want them to, GOD ALWAYS KNOWS WHAT HE IS DOING. And even when it seems like God hasn t been fair, GOD ALWAYS KNOWS WHAT HE IS DOING. And He will always do what is best and what is right. It is our job to keep believing Him and keep obeying Him. He will always make things turn out right. Let s learn our memory verse: John 11:25 - Jesus said unto her, I am the resurrection, and the life: he that believeth in me, though he were dead, yet shall he live.

Teen and Adult Lesson Year Two, Quarter Three, Lesson Eleven SUNDAY SCHOOL LESSON The Life of Jesus Teacher, choose one of the following truths to expand upon in teaching this portion of Scripture to your teen/adult class. Teach and apply the truth that you choose using statements and illustrations that are most helpful and applicable to your students. I. GOD KNOWS ALL ABOUT EVERY PROBLEM WE FACE BEFORE WE BEGIN TO EXPERIENCE THE PROBLEM. 11:4. When we face a huge hardship in life, there is always that moment when we first become aware of the hardship a phone call, a text, a letter, a message that the boss wants to see you in his office, or the doctor saying, There s something we need to discuss. We look back at those devastating moments as moments that instantly changed our lives, moments that we didn t see coming. But not only does God know those moments are coming, He knows everything about the problem, its purpose, its solution, and its potential to bring us good. If we will simply strive to get God involved in the problem, He will take it from there. II. EVERY PROBLEM I HAVE HAS TO POTENTIAL TO BRING GLORY TO GOD. 11:4, 41-45. God is the ultimate problem-solver. There is no problem that is too big for Him. He may not work it out the way we expect Him to or want Him to, but His solutions are better than what we might imagine. When God does solve a problem, it reveals His great character and power to everyone who is watching. We must let God be our problem-solver, so He can bring people closer to Himself. III. GOD DOES NOT VIEW DEATH THE SAME WAY THAT WE VIEW DEATH. 11:11-16. Jesus disciples, along with Mary and Martha, viewed death as final and hopeless, as something that is even beyond God s jurisdiction. Jesus viewed death as something completely under God s control, which He can use for the very best purposes. Our faith is strengthened when we learn to view things that way God views them, including death. IV. WHEN WE BEGIN TO BLAME GOD FOR NEGLECTING US, OUR FAITH HAS WEAKEND. 11:21, 32. Mary and Martha s words are exactly the same, which indicates that they had been discussing this matter among themselves. Their words imply that it is too late for Jesus to do any good. They are some of Jesus closest friends, yet their faith has reached a limit. True faith trusts God no matter what the circumstances are telling us. V. GOD GRIEVES WITH US WHEN WE GRIEVE. 11:33-35. The classic question about John 11:35 is that, if Jesus knew He was about to bring Lazarus back to life, why did He weep. The answer is simple and wonderful: Jesus wept because the people He loved were weeping. Even though Jesus know that something great was about to happen, His close friends had been grieving for four days, and He loved them so much that He wanted the grieve with them. He did not let His own faith be demonstrated as, I m better than you and I have more faith than you have. He shows us how to love others who may not see hope as clearly as we do.

The Raising of Lazarus John11:1-46 Jesus, the Answer I. JOHN 11:1-16 Jesus Disciples Question His Decision Don t go right now, it s too dangerous! II. JOHN 11:17-32 Jesus Friends Question His Timing If you had come sooner, you could have helped! III. JOHN 11:33-37 Jesus Critics Question His Power I thought you were the big Healer! IV. JOHN 11:38-44 Jesus Actions Answer All Their Questions To His disciples: If I can deliver from death, who can hurt you? To His friends: If I am the Resurrection, when is too late? To His critics: What is your reason for not believing now? V. JOHN 11:45-46 Everyone Responds Accordingly Believers will believe; critics will criticize. Adult Bible Class
